House Restoration in Charleston, SC
House restoration services encompass a range of projects aimed at repairing, renovating, and revitalizing residential properties. These services typically include restoring aging or damaged exteriors, updating interior finishes, repairing structural elements, and addressing issues such as water damage, rot, or deterioration. Property owners often seek house restoration to preserve the value of their homes, improve safety, or prepare a property for sale or occupancy. Before requesting restoration services, homeowners should consider the scope of work needed, any specific issues like mold or foundation concerns, and desired outcomes to ensure the project aligns with their goals.
Understanding the condition of the property and the extent of repairs required is essential when requesting house restoration. Homeowners usually want clarity on the types of materials used, the estimated timeframe, and the overall process involved in restoring their home. It’s also helpful to identify any particular features or details they wish to preserve or enhance, such as historic elements or custom finishes. Clear communication about project expectations can support a smooth restoration process and help achieve results that meet property owners’ needs.

Common House Restoration Jobs
Interior Restoration - involves repairing and updating walls, ceilings, and flooring to improve home comfort and appearance.
Kitchen Renovation - includes updating cabinetry, countertops, and fixtures to enhance functionality and style.
Bathroom Remodeling - focuses on modernizing fixtures, tiles, and layouts for better usability.
Roof Repair and Replacement - addresses leaks, damage, and aging roofs to protect the property.
Foundation Repair - stabilizes and reinforces the building’s base to prevent structural issues.
Exterior Restoration - restores siding, windows, and doors to boost curb appeal and weather resistance.
House Restoration Questions
What types of house restoration services are available? Services include repairing damaged walls, restoring historic features, updating exteriors, and addressing structural issues to improve home durability and appearance.
How do I know if my home needs restoration work? Signs such as water damage, mold growth, peeling paint, or structural cracks indicate that restoration may be necessary to maintain safety and value.
What materials are used in house restoration projects? Restoration projects typically involve using period-appropriate materials, durable modern options, and environmentally compatible products to match the home's original style and ensure longevity.
What should property owners consider before starting restoration? It is important to assess the home's current condition, prioritize repairs, and choose materials and styles that preserve or enhance the property's character.
